Handy Features 3 Setting the LCD Monitor Off/On You can enable or disable the LCD monitor's shooting settings display (p.42) from turning on when the shutter button is pressed halfway. Under the [5] tab, select [LCD off/on btn], then press . Select one of the settings below, then press . [Shutter btn.]: The display turns off when you press the shutter button halfway, and reappears when you let go of the shutter button. [Shutter/DISP]: The display turns off when you press the shutter button halfway, and remains off after you let go of the shutter button. To turn on the display, press the button or . [Remains on]: The display does not turn off when you press the shutter button halfway. To turn off the display, press the button or . 3 Changing the Shooting Settings Screen Color You can change the background color of the shooting settings screen. Select [Screen color]. Under the [5] tab, select [Screen color], then press . Select the desired color, then press . When you exit the menu, the selected color will be displayed for the shooting settings screen. 115
